...Since around 1956, cultivation of rice fields has been progressing in the valley bottoms carving into the hills, and in recent years, in addition to rice cultivation, dairy farming, apple production, and flower cultivation have increased. Ojojihara in the northwest, which accounts for about 20% of the village's area, became an army training ground at the end of the Meiji era, and was requisitioned by the US military after World War II. It is now a training ground for the Japan Ground Self-Defense Force. National Route 4 runs through the village. ...

From Iroma Town

...Rice farming is the main focus, but apple and other fruit cultivation, dairy farming, and livestock farming are also popular, and in recent years the area has been diversifying. Ojojihara on the Hanakawa alluvial fan has been used as an army training ground since 1908, and is still the site of a training ground for the Japan Ground Self-Defense Force today, but after World War II, some settlements were established and development progressed, focusing on dairy farming. The remains of tile kilns in the Hinodeyama area in the east are believed to have been used to fire tiles for Taga Castle and other places, and have been designated a historic site. ...
